Available Programs
MaineCare Elderly and Adults with Disabilities Waiver
This HCBS Medicaid waiver provides home-based long-term care services for seniors 65+ at risk of nursing home placement.
Maine Long-Term Care Ombudsman Program
The Ombudsman Program advocates for residents of long-term care facilities, investigating complaints.
Maine Senior Health Insurance Assistance Program (SHIP)
Maine SHIP offers free, unbiased counseling on Medicare, Medicare Savings Programs, and coverage options.
Maine State SSI Supplement
Maine provides a small monthly SSI state supplement to eligible SSI recipients who are aged, blind, or disabled.
MaineCare Medicare Savings Programs
Maine's Medicare Savings Programs (QMB, SLMB, QI) help low-income Medicare beneficiaries pay costs.
Maine Family Caregiver Support Program
Offers support to family caregivers of seniors 60+, including respite care, counseling, and training.
MaineCare Aged, Blind, and Disabled
MaineCare is Maine's Medicaid program providing health coverage for seniors aged 65+ with limited income.
Maine SNAP
Maine's SNAP provides monthly benefits via EBT card to low-income seniors for purchasing nutritious food.
Maine Home-Delivered Meals
Provides nutritious meals delivered to homebound seniors through Area Agencies on Aging.
Legal Services for Maine's Elders
Provides free legal assistance to Mainers aged 60+ on issues like benefits, housing, and elder abuse.
Maine Property Tax Stabilization for Seniors
Provides property tax stabilization for eligible seniors and disabled homeowners, freezing assessments.
Maine Heating Assistance / LIHEAP
Maine's LIHEAP helps low-income households, including seniors, pay heating costs in winter months.
